《HyperLynx DDR3仿真验证套件综合文档》是一份全面指南,专为使用HyperLynx工具进行DDR3布线和信号完整性分析的设计工程师而设计。该文档整合了详细的仿真步骤、实例以及最佳实践,帮助用户优化DDR3系统的性能与稳定性。
HyperLynx DDR3仿真验证套包综合文档涵盖了使用HyperLynx软件进行DDR3(双倍数据速率第三代)内存接口设计仿真与验证的核心技术与操作指南。HyperLynx是由Mentor Graphics公司开发的一款强大的信号完整性、电源完整性和电磁兼容性分析工具集,它能够帮助工程师在PCB(印制电路板)设计阶段预测并解决可能出现的问题。DDR3作为高速存储器接口标准,其性能对于整个系统的速度至关重要。因此,使用HyperLynx DDR3仿真验证套包进行设计前的仿真与验证对于确保产品性能和可靠性是必不可少的。
知识点一:DDR3内存标准与特性
DDR3是现代计算机和嵌入式系统中常用的高速动态随机存取存储器(DRAM)类型之一。它在前一代技术DDR2的基础上做了显著改进,包括更高数据传输速率、更低的工作电压、改进的数据预取算法和增加的突发长度等。DDR3通常的工作电压为1.5V,相较于DDR2的1.8V,有助于减少功耗。此外,DDR3提供了更高的数据传输速率,这归功于其新的时钟频率和数据速率。例如,典型的DDR3内存条的数据速率可以从800 Mbps到更高的2133 Mbps不等。
知识点二:HyperLynx软件在DDR3仿真中的作用
HyperLynx软件主要用于在PCB设计阶段对信号完整性、电源完整性和EMI(电磁干扰)等问题进行分析。对于DDR3这样的高速内存接口,信号完整性尤其重要,因为它直接关系到数据在存储器与控制器间传输的准确性和稳定性。HyperLynx能够模拟DDR3信号在电路中的行为,并预测可能出现的问题,如信号反射、串扰、过冲下冲以及时序违规等。通过这些仿真,设计人员可以提前调整和优化设计,减少设计反复,缩短产品上市时间。
知识点三:HyperLynx DDR3仿真验证套包的组成
HyperLynx DDR3仿真验证套包通常包含多种工具组件,以支持DDR3内存设计的全方位验证。这些组件可能包括:
1. HyperLynx Signal Integrity工具:用于进行信号完整性分析,包括时序分析、传输线分析、反射和串扰分析等。
2. HyperLynx Power Integrity工具:用于进行电源完整性分析,确保电源与地平面设计符合DDR3接口的供电要求。
3. HyperLynx BoardSim工具:提供了一个交互式的仿真环境,用于模拟整个电路板的行为。
4. HyperLynx LineSim工具:允许用户模拟高速信号传输线的行为,特别是针对DDR3数据线和时钟线的特定参数进行分析和优化。
知识点四:DDR3设计流程中的关键考虑点
在使用HyperLynx DDR3仿真验证套包进行DDR3设计时,设计师需要关注一系列的关键点,以确保设计满足性能要求:
1. 设计规范:了解DDR3的电气和时序规范是非常重要的,包括数据速率、时钟频率、时序参数等。
2. 布线策略:高速信号的布线策略对信号完整性至关重要,需要关注线宽、线间距、阻抗匹配和布线长度。
3. 终端匹配:适当的终端匹配技术能够减少信号反射,确保信号的稳定传输。
4. 时序预算:时序的严格管理是确保DDR3接口可靠运行的关键,设计中应为信号传输留有足够的时序预算。
5. 电源和地平面设计:优化的电源和地平面设计对于减少电磁干扰和提供稳定的电源至关重要。
知识点五:HyperLynx DDR3仿真验证的实际应用
在实际应用中,HyperLynx DDR3仿真验证套包通常在设计阶段的早期被引入,以确保设计满足性能和可靠性要求。设计师可以在实际PCB制造和组装前进行多次仿真,包括:
1. DDR3接口预布局:在实际布局前进行初步的信号和电源仿真,以确保设计的可行性。
2. 布局后仿真:完成布局后的仿真用于验证设计的实际性能,并与规范做比较。
3. 设计修改和迭代:通过仿真结果对设计进行必要的调整,并进行再次仿真以验证改进效果。
4. 最终验证:在设计修改完成后,进行最终的全面验证,以确保设计满足所有性能指标。
知识点六:HyperLynx DDR3仿真验证套包的优势和局限性
HyperLynx DDR3仿真验证套包具有许多优势,比如它能够提供精确的DDR3设计仿真结果,帮助设计师在物理PCB制造之前发现并解决问题。该套包支持高级仿真技术,如S参数模型,能够模拟高频信号的真实行为。此外,它还支持与主流EDA(电子设计自动化)工具的集成,简化了